Milgram's Study
Experiments led by Stanley Milgram in social psychology that assessed how much individuals would follow orders from an authority figure to do things that go against their own moral judgment.
Obedience to Authority
The act of following orders or directives from someone in a position of power, often without questioning them.

Milgram
A psychologist who conducted experiments on obedience, demonstrating the power of authority in compelling individuals to act against their personal conscience.
